Surat: The Sheladia family's tradition of service becomes an example, 106 people pledge to donate eyes and bodies

 

The inspiring service tradition of the Bhagats Veerbapa Sheladia family from the village of Bada Samadhiya has emerged as a model for society, thanks to the grace of Swaminarayan Bhagwan. The family's social services, linked to former mayor Asmitaben Shiroya's maternal side, continue to inspire new generations.

According to information provided by Dr. Praful Shiroya, Aksharnivasi Sonbai Ba (106 years) witnessed five generations during her lifetime and fulfilled her pledge of 'eye donation is a great donation' by donating her eyes after her death. Her husband, Aksharnivasi Bachubapa, who was a respected village elder of Bada Samadhiya, also dedicated his life to social service and donated his eyes after passing away.

Inspired by these noble values, their eldest son Aksharnivasi Babubhai Bachubhai Sheladia also donated his eyes, continuing the family's tradition. Additionally, the family's sister-in-law Aksharnivasi Diwaliben Bhikhabhai Sheladia donated her eyes and body after her death in Surat, providing new direction to society. Inspired by the ideals of the family's elders, the entire Sheladia family has now taken a grand pledge for eye and body donation.

Many members from five generations of Sonbai Ba have come forward to set a new example in society through this noble work. On the occasion of the twelfth ritual, 106 people pledged to donate their eyes, bodies, and organs after death.

A blood donation camp was also organized on this occasion, while the Bhagirath Youth Mandal presented a heartfelt program of devotional songs. Members from various organizations, including Dineshbhai Jogani, Lion Kishor Mangrolia, Lion Jagdish Bodra, Saurashtra Patel Samaj, Lok Drishti Eye Bank, Red Cross Blood Bank Surat, and Lions Club of Surat East, praised the family's spirit of service and deemed it inspirational for society.
